    I always allocate around $100-$200 to do a long shot bet that could pay big when i visit Vegas. This time I have chosen to hit up a slot machine. I'm not much a slot player so I'd like opinions on what slot to try.

    I'd obviously play max bet on the machine. I'm assuming a machine with $3 max bet ($1 dollar machine) to $10 max bet.($5 dollar 2 "coin" machine)
    If I get a hit that doubles my money or more, I'll just cash out.

    Got back from my trip. I picked the $5 wheel of fortune machine right outside the HL area. Played max credits (2). On the second spin, I got to spin the wheel. Ended up $400! Cashed out immediately after!

    Mission accomplished!
